1995 Ford Fiesta freestyle review from UK and Ireland
"A bargain first car"
What things have gone wrong with the car?
Power Steering Belt started to go at 50,000 miles.
Brake Cylinders weeping fluid at 51,000.
Tracking needed doing at 53,000.
General comments?
I love this car, I bought it for £800 with 49,000 miles on the clock. Had a few spots of rust, which after a couple of days of sanding and spraying, are now gone. Starts first time every time, no matter what the temperature. No rattles or squeeks. Very comfy.
Not exactly powerful, but you get what you payfor with the fiesta, you wouldn't be able to pick up a lotus for £800!!!
I'm planning on keeping this car for years, going to go well over 100,000 miles.
